Pressure Washing Wood Surfaces



When pressure washing timber surfaces, it's vital to pick the right equipment and strategy to avoid damage. Beginning by picking a stress washing machine with flexible settings. A lower pressure, normally in between 1,200 to 1,500 PSI, is perfect for timber. This helps avoid gouging or stripping the timber fibers.

Prior to you begin, make sure to get rid of the location of furnishings, plants, and other challenges. It's important to test a tiny, inconspicuous section initially to guarantee your strategy and stress settings won't hurt the surface area.

Utilize a follower nozzle attachment for an even circulation of water. Hold the nozzle at a 45-degree angle and a minimum of 12 inches far from the timber to lessen the threat of damage.

As you clean, relocate long, sweeping activities along the grain of the timber. This strategy assists lift dust and debris efficiently without leaving streaks.

After washing, rinse the surface completely to remove any kind of continuing to be cleansing solution. Enable the timber to dry entirely prior to applying any kind of sealer or discolor. Adhering to these actions will ensure your timber surfaces continue to be in terrific condition while looking fresh and tidy.

Methods for Cleaning Concrete



Concrete surfaces can gather dirt, gunk, and discolorations with time, making effective cleansing techniques essential. To begin, you'll intend to make use of a pressure washer with a minimum of 3000 PSI for concrete cleaning. This degree of stress effectively gets rid of persistent discolorations without harming the surface area.

Next, connect a vast spray nozzle to your pressure washer, preferably a 25-degree or 40-degree suggestion. This will certainly disperse the water evenly and lessen the risk of etching.



When you start pressure washing, operate in areas. Keep the nozzle about 12 inches from the surface area and preserve a constant, sweeping motion. This method ensures you don't miss out on any places or apply too much stress in one area.

For specifically stubborn spots, you might need to repeat the procedure or use a more focused cleaner.

Lastly, rinse the location extensively after cleaning. This action stops any kind of residue from remaining on the concrete, leaving it clean and looking fresh.

Best Practices for Plastic Siding



Plastic exterior siding is a prominent option for home owners as a result of its durability and reduced maintenance needs. Nevertheless, to keep it looking its best, you'll need to press laundry it occasionally.

Begin by preparing the area-- eliminate any type of furnishings, plants, or challenges near your home. Next off, choose a pressure washing machine with a nozzle that provides a wide spray; commonly, a 25-degree nozzle works well.

Before you begin, test a small section to ensure your settings will not damage the siding. Keep the stress below 2000 PSI to stay clear of any damages or cracks. Start from all-time low and function your method up, washing in sections to stop streaks.
